语音视频聊天SDK如何实现音视频通话静音提醒?
随着互联网技术的飞速发展,语音视频聊天SDK已成为人们日常生活中不可或缺的一部分。在音视频通话过程中,有时需要对方保持静音,以确保通话质量或避免打扰他人。然而,如何实现音视频通话的静音提醒功能,成为开发者关注的焦点。本文将详细探讨语音视频聊天SDK如何实现音视频通话静音提醒。
一、静音提醒功能的意义
提高通话质量:在音视频通话过程中,若一方处于静音状态,可以避免噪音干扰,提高通话质量。
避免打扰他人:在公共场合或需要保持安静的环境中,静音提醒功能可以帮助用户及时了解通话状态,避免打扰他人。
体现尊重:在特定场合,如会议、讲座等,静音提醒功能可以让对方感受到尊重,有利于维护良好的沟通氛围。
二、实现音视频通话静音提醒的方法
- 语音提示
(1)语音库:开发者可以使用语音合成技术,将静音提醒信息转化为语音。常见的语音合成库有百度语音、科大讯飞等。
(2)播放方式:在对方静音时,通过语音播放器将静音提醒信息播放给对方。播放方式可以采用实时播放、定时播放或触发播放。
- 图形提示
(1)界面设计:在通话界面添加静音提醒图标,如耳机、静音按钮等。当对方静音时,图标变为红色或黄色,以提示用户。
(2)动画效果:为静音提醒图标添加动画效果,如闪烁、跳动等,以增强提示效果。
- 消息提示
(1)文字消息:在通话界面下方或聊天窗口中显示静音提醒文字,如“对方已静音”、“请勿打扰”等。
(2)消息推送:通过消息推送技术,将静音提醒信息发送给对方手机,确保对方及时了解通话状态。
- 音频提示
(1)背景音乐:在通话过程中,播放一段低音量的背景音乐,当对方静音时,音乐音量降低,以提示用户。
(2)音效:使用特定的音效,如蜂鸣声、警告声等,在对方静音时播放,以引起对方注意。
三、实现静音提醒功能的注意事项
提示时机:在对方静音时及时发出提醒,避免对方长时间处于静音状态而不知情。
提示方式:根据实际需求选择合适的提示方式,如语音、图形、消息或音频等。
提示音量:确保提示音量适中,既不会打扰他人,又能让用户清晰听到。
用户自定义:允许用户根据个人喜好调整静音提醒功能,如开启/关闭提醒、选择提醒方式等。
兼容性:确保静音提醒功能在多种设备和操作系统上正常运行。
总结
语音视频聊天SDK实现音视频通话静音提醒功能,有助于提高通话质量、避免打扰他人,并体现尊重。开发者可以根据实际需求,选择合适的提示方式,确保用户在使用过程中获得良好的体验。同时,关注兼容性和用户自定义,让静音提醒功能更加完善。
猜你喜欢:直播云服务平台